On 23 November 2006 09:00, Angelo Graziosi wrote:
> I would ask if there is an utility that transforme an .exe.stackdump
> (bootstrap-emacs.exe.stackdump, for example) file in human-readable
> informations.
Cut and paste the column of EIP values into "addr2line" is about the best
you'll get.
> Another ask is if, in Cygwin, is possible to produce a core dump file.
/bin/dumper.exe
